
Earlier today we heard that the new LG G6 would come with a new user interface in the form of UX 6.0 and LG has now released a teaser video for the UI.
In the video below we get to have a brief look at the new LG UX 6.0 user interface which will launch when the new LG G6 is unveiled later this month.
Enhanced User Experience with UX 6.0
The UX 6.0 user interface is designed to provide a more intuitive and user-friendly experience. It features a range of enhancements and new functionalities aimed at making the device easier to use. One of the key highlights of UX 6.0 is its improved multitasking capabilities. The interface allows users to run two apps side by side, taking full advantage of the 18:9 aspect ratio of the display. This is particularly useful for productivity tasks, such as browsing the web while taking notes or watching a video while chatting with friends.
Another significant improvement is the camera interface. UX 6.0 introduces new camera modes and features that make capturing photos and videos more enjoyable and versatile. For instance, the Square Camera mode is designed for social media enthusiasts, allowing them to take perfectly square photos that are ready to be uploaded to platforms like Instagram without any cropping.
Impressive Hardware Specifications
Hardware-wise, the LG G6 will feature a 5.7-inch display with a QHD+ resolution of 2880 x 1440 pixels and an aspect ratio of 18:9. This aspect ratio is taller than the traditional 16:9, providing more screen real estate for users to enjoy their content. The display also supports HDR10 and Dolby Vision, ensuring vibrant colors and excellent contrast for an immersive viewing experience.
The handset will be powered by a Snapdragon 821 processor, which, while not the latest chipset at the time of its release, is still a very capable and efficient processor. It will also come with 4GB of RAM, ensuring smooth performance and the ability to handle multiple apps and tasks simultaneously. The device will feature 32GB or 64GB of internal storage, expandable via a microSD card slot, providing ample space for apps, photos, and videos.
The LG G6 will also boast dual rear cameras, which have become a staple in modern smartphones. The primary camera will be a 13-megapixel sensor with a wide-angle lens, while the secondary camera will offer a standard angle lens. This dual-camera setup allows for greater flexibility in photography, enabling users to capture wide-angle shots of landscapes and group photos, as well as standard shots with more detail.
Additionally, the LG G6 will come equipped with a Quad DAC (Digital-to-Analog Converter), which is a feature aimed at audiophiles. The Quad DAC ensures high-quality audio output, providing a superior listening experience whether you’re using wired headphones or external speakers.
The new LG G6 will be made official at a Mobile World Congress press conference on the 26th of February. This event is highly anticipated, as it will provide more details about the handset, including its pricing and availability.
